Preservation and promotion of public health by increasing the availability and quality of high-tech medical care is one of the priorities of the state policy [1]. In the current situation, great importance is given to the foundation of modern trauma and orthopedic departments focusing on the treatment of various pathologies of motor functions. The research objective is to highlight modern possibilities of the traumatology and orthopedics department of the in-patient department of N.A. Semashko Northern Medical Clinical Center.
Materials and methods: the materials used were official statistics data from the annual reports of the head of the traumatology and orthopedics department of the N.A. Semashko Center. Results and discussion: hundreds of large joint endoprosthetic surgeries are annually performed in the traumatology and orthopedic department of the Semashko Center’s in-patient department. Physicians are proficient in the technique of unicondylar prosthetics, successfully use dual mobility systems for complex revision endoprosthetics, and use special trabecular tantalum structures to replace extensive bone defects.
Conclusion: with respect to the complexity of performed surgical interventions, the department matches federal clinics, and many operations performed by specialists of the department are rare even in metropolitan medical centers because of their complexity and cost.
The presented material is dedicated to the outstanding surgeon, the legend of Arkhangelsk public health care - Yakov Alexandrovich Nasonov. The research objective is to show the contribution of the famous surgeon to the development of the First City Hospital and regional surgery.
Materials and methods: a retrospective historical-analytical study was carried out. Ideographic and problem-chronological methods were used. Information was taken from Internet sources from the websites of E.E.Volosevich First City Hospital, the Ministry of Arkhangelsk Healthcare, Arkhangelsk Regional Assembly of Deputies. Results and discussion: biographical material from the life and activities of the surgeon Y.A.Nasonov demonstrates his significant contribution to the medicine development. His practical methods and innovations in a wide range of surgical care created a solid and effective foundation for the development of a number of new fields of surgery in the First City Hospital.
Conclusion: life of Yakov Alexandrovich Nasonov is a bright example of the wholehearted service to medicine. He gave more than half a century to the work in the First City Hospital, trained a whole galaxy of talented surgeons, made a significant contribution to the development of regional surgery and practical healthcare in the Arkhangelsk region
